Hyderabad: HP launched its new Envy portfolio on Tuesday to cater to the evolving demands of content creators. The new portfolio, comprising Envy 14 and Envy 15 notebooks, aim to give users the freedom to create from anywhere, power their creativity with design, and offer a seamless experience as they shift between different modes of creative output.
The HP Envy 14 is available at a starting price of Rs 1,04,999 and Envy 15 at a starting price of Rs 1,54,999. The HP Envy portfolio is available at HP World Stores, large retail outlets such as Reliance, Croma, and e-commerce sites such as Amazon, Flipkart and major multi brand outlets.
The new portfolio is expected to be upgradeable to Windows 11 later this year. The HP Envy notebooks are sleek personal creative studios, suited for a diverse range of creative users such as photographers, designers, videographers, music composers or illustrators.

Core features
The HP Envy 14 is built with an immersive 14” display that delivers precise colours, offering users a bigger canvas to work on. It provides a 16:10 display that offers 11 per cent greater viewing area than a traditional 16:9 laptop. It is powered with 11th Gen Intel Core processors 5 and Nvidia GeForce GTX 1650 Ti Max-Q design graphics to bring faster rendering, seamless playback, and smooth multitasking.
The HP Envy 14 has an IR thermal sensor, thin-blade fans and heat pipes to keep the PC cool throughout the day. The device is equipped with optimum power up to 16.5 hours of battery life, and protects battery health with adaptive battery optimiser.
HP Envy 14 is optimised with creative software programmes and tools typically used by creators including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Premiere Pro and Adobe Lightroom. It facilitates collaboration by offering HP QuickDrop to transfer photos, videos, documents, and more, wirelessly between PC and mobile devices.
The HP Envy 15 is made with a 15.6” display that ensures prograde performance. The device is built with 11th Gen Intel Core processors and Nvidia GeForce RTX 3060 (MQ). It also offers gaming-class thermals to power through intensive workloads.
It is equipped with optimum power upto16.5 hours of battery life and is optimised with creative software programmes and tools typically used by creators including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Premiere Pro and Adobe Lightroom.
